Summary
The Starlink-1931 satellite, also known as Alt Name: Starlink 1931, is a communication satellite operated by SPXS (SpaceX). Launched on October 24, 2020, from LC40 at the Air Force Eastern Test Range using a Falcon 9 launch vehicle, it has a dry mass of 248 kg and a launch mass of 260 kg. The satellite measures 0.2 meters in length with a diameter of 2.8 meters and spans 9 meters. It is equipped with Ku/Ka-band payload capabilities (all) and includes optical inter-satellite links on a few prototypes. Its power system consists of solar arrays and batteries, while its propulsion system uses krypton ion thrusters. The satellite's shape is described as box plus pan configuration.

Starlink is a satellite constellation developed by SpaceX with the aim of providing global broadband internet coverage. Thousands of small satellites are deployed in low Earth orbit (LEO), enabling high-speed internet access even in remote areas. However, the rapid increase in satellites raises concerns about space debris and the potential for collisions, which can lead to further debris creation and endanger other spacecraft. Additionally, the sheer number of Starlink satellites can affect astronomical observations by increasing light pollution. Proper deorbiting plans and international coordination are essential to mitigate these challenges and ensure long-term sustainability in space.
